A VP of Midwest Sales Arrives At AdLarge

AdLarge's newest sales exec began his career as a media buyer at what is now OMD Chicago and moved into ad sales at A&E and Rolling Stone magazine before landing in audio. He has held sales executive positions at Premiere Radio Networks, Westwood One, MJI Broadcasting, Univision, and Spanish Broadcasting System.
